Rationale for change

In the previous suggestion, @Michael_B states "[...] the equatorial position is parallel to the ring's plane" but the question asks about bonds in relation to the AXIS of the ring, which is pependicular to the plane of the ring. The axis goes through the middle of the ring. ie) axial bonds are parallel to the axis of the ring and equatorial bonds are perpendicular to the axis of the ring.
